Abstract

This investigation explores the plasmonic effect on molecular fluorescence within ternary liquid systems comprising 7-amino-4-(trifluoromethyl) coumarin (C-151) laser dye, ethanol, and benzaldehyde. A key aspect of our investigation involves examining ZrN nanosphere and ZrN nanoshell within these mixtures, marking the first instance of such an analysis in ZrN and ternary liquid compositions. Utilizing experimentally obtained refractive indices, we evaluate resonance peaks in the spectra and their shifts. Our findings reveal improved fluorescence characteristics in C-151 laser dye with the addition of ZrN nanoparticles. Theoretical results suggest that plasmonic nanoparticles play a significant role in enhancing dye fluorescence. These findings deepen our understanding of plasmonics in complex liquid environments and highlight ZrN's potential as an effective alternative plasmonic material for efficient molecular energy transfer at the nanoscale.
